Django跟Flask如何查找并过滤model的属性字段
发表于:2025-02-01 作者:千家信息网编辑
千家信息网最后更新 2025年02月01日,本篇内容主要讲解"Django跟Flask如何查找并过滤model的属性字段",感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习"Django跟Flask如何查找
千家信息网最后更新 2025年02月01日Django跟Flask如何查找并过滤model的属性字段
本篇内容主要讲解"Django跟Flask如何查找并过滤model的属性字段",感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习"Django跟Flask如何查找并过滤model的属性字段"吧!
在Django/Flask后端开发中,我们经常性要对model进行添加或修改操作,前端提交过来的数据是一个字典,有些情况下,前端提交过来的某些数据并不一定是model的属性字段,所以,我们要把不是model中的字段去掉。 通常有两种方法,最简便的方便就是对前端发送过来的 data 进行pop操作,下面再介绍另外一种方法:
添加或修改Model时对数据进行检测,把不在model中的属性字段过滤掉
# for django
def model_check(model, data): return dict([(k, data[k]) for k in data.keys() if k in [x.name for x in model._meta.fields]])
# for flask (SQLAlchemy orm )
def model_check(model, data): return dict([(k, data[k]) for k in data.keys() if k in [x.name for x in model.__table__.columns]])
到此,相信大家对"Django跟Flask如何查找并过滤model的属性字段"有了更深的了解,不妨来实际操作一番吧!这里是网站,更多相关内容可以进入相关频道进行查询,关注我们,继续学习!
字段
属性
前端
数据
方法
内容
学习
实用
更深
简便
兴趣
字典
实用性
实际
就是
情况
操作简单
更多
朋友
经常性
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
X网络安全管理员招生
软件开发大学一般是什么专业
分布式数据库如何查询
Ibm服务器带内管理
gpu服务器基础
端端软件开发
服务器管理卡修改时间
好口碑电脑服务器托管公司
未来之役服务器怎么选欧服
福建搜索互联网科技有限公司
mtk软件开发需要什么
数据库实训的技术总结
手机3d扫描软件开发
基岩版优秀的服务器
软件开发对计算机要求
tbc不同服务器怎么用
服务器开机风扇反复转
湘潭网站建设软件开发
软件开发项目合同公示
坂田服务器机柜加工
软件开发大学一般是什么专业
郴州字牌软件开发
网络安全监督检查工作报告
化妆品导航软件开发
工商软件开发中心的优势
穿越火线东西南北部服务器
access数据库 vf
安徽达光网络技术有限公司
如何让dll控制数据库
sql数据库月份